Kamalul Ihsan Mosque is a community mosque in Min Buri, Bangkok, located around Rat Uthit Road and Rat Uthit 26 Alley (near Saeng Wiman Alley / Saeng Man Village). The surrounding area feels like a lived-in neighborhood—simple, steady, and continuously used as a place of worship. If you are looking for a mosque in eastern Bangkok for religious activities, or you would like to learn about the Muslim community context in Min Buri in a respectful way, this is a place worth visiting with the right manners and intention.
 
The charm of a community mosque is not the flashy feeling of a tourist landmark, but the “calm and realness” of a place that is genuinely used for worship day after day. You can sense orderliness, cleanliness, and an atmosphere that supports quiet focus. When you come with respect, both the community and the place tend to welcome your learning in a gentle, natural way.
 
In terms of its role, Kamalul Ihsan Mosque serves as a religious center for people in the area and a meaningful space for gathering, meeting, and community coordination in the Saen Saep–Min Buri zone. The importance of a mosque like this is not measured only by the size of the building, but by the continuity of its use and the collective care of people who help keep the sacred space active and sustainable.

When visiting a religious place as someone who wants to learn, the key is behaving appropriately: dress modestly, keep your voice down, and avoid disrupting prayer times. If you want to take photos, be careful not to capture individuals in the prayer area, and when necessary, ask for permission to ensure everyone feels comfortable. A simple principle works well: “Respect the place, respect the people,” and the visit will likely be smooth.
 
Getting There If you are driving, you can take Rat Uthit Road and enter Rat Uthit 26 Alley (near Saeng Wiman Alley). Then pin the destination by the mosque name and watch the final stretch, which runs through smaller community streets. It’s a good idea to allow extra time, especially during morning and evening rush hours when traffic in eastern Bangkok can get heavy. If you are using public transport, a practical approach is to go to an easy transfer point in Min Buri or Ram Inthra, then take a taxi or motorcycle taxi for the last part for clarity. And if you want to visit at a specific time, calling ahead before you leave can help everything go more smoothly.
